... Read moreFrom my own experience and observations, it's clear that today's kids face many obstacles that discourage outdoor play. Restrictions like bans on skateboarding and loitering, coupled with insufficient funding for parks and public transportation, create unwelcoming environments. Even simple activities such as drumming in your yard or visiting libraries during evenings and weekends are often limited, making it hard for young people to find safe and inviting public spaces. Moreover, the high costs associated with leisure activities like movies further restrict access to social outings. It feels like adults impose rules and restrictions that undermine children’s freedom to explore and enjoy their surroundings, yet simultaneously blame them for 'being up to no good.' This contradiction adds to the frustration of young people. Research highlighted by linguist Gretchen McCulloch confirms that teens and young adults crave outdoor socialization but struggle to find spaces where they can exist without fear of punishment or exclusion. The lack of inclusive, affordable, and youth-friendly public areas pushes many towards online communities where social interaction is easier and freer. It's important for communities to rethink how public spaces are managed and funded, ensuring they cater to the needs of all age groups. Encouraging outdoor play isn’t just about providing parks but also about creating welcoming environments where kids feel safe, valued, and free to express themselves. Only then can we hope to see a reversal in the trend of kids staying indoors and reconnecting with the benefits of outdoor play and sociability.
